Pumpkin Spice Slice: NJ Pizza Chain Takes Fall Flavor Obsession To New Level
The chain, headquartered in Morristown, is hoping you'll fall for their new pumpkin spice slice. Would you try this?
MORRISTOWN, NJ — It started with lattes, then spilled on over into just about, well, everything. It's hard to walk around a grocery store or into a restaurant this season without seeing pumpkin spice versions of your favorite foods, but pizza has generally been free from the trendy flavoring.
Until today.
Morristown, New Jersey-based Villa Pizza, a popular national pizza chain, is introducing pumpkin spice pizza for one day only on Friday, Sept. 22, to celebrate the first day of fall.

The pizza has pumpkin pie filling, traditional pumpkin pie spices, and mozzarella. No word on if it pairs better with a pumpkin spice latte or just a regular soda. "Pumpkin Spice is undeniably the most popular flavor of fall. As such, we wanted to slice up our piece of the pie," a Villa Italian Kitchen spokesperson told Vice. "We thought, what could be better than combining the popularity of Pumpkin Spice with pizza?"

Want to try the pumpkin spice slice? Villa Pizza has a number of New Jersey locations, including Tinton Falls, Newark, Edison and Blackwood. (Their Morristown location is just an office.)
